This research paper aims to explicate how an individual’s ideas are profoundly affected through the social encounters in one’s life. These encounters can lead the way for unanticipated realizations and an out-and-out change in one’s perceptions and personality. Umera Ahmad has depicted this change in her novella Shehr- e- Zaat (City of Self). The protagonist, Falak Sher Afghan undergoes numerous realizations. From a world of materialism and glamour, she moves to the other end of the spectrum by immersing herself in the love of God. The research paper is an attempt to answer some pertinent questions such as, what drives Falak to renounce materialistic pleasures and adopt a simple and sagacious life? What does she make of all the encounters throughout her life? Are there other characters too, who undergo major transformations? If yes, who are they? And why do they change? This paper has tried to explore these questions in depth and tried to find answers to them.
